Upper & Lower Ball Joints: Installation

  1. Install new ball joint using bolts and nuts in place of rivets. Tighten upper and lower ball joint mounting nuts to specification. See TORQUE SPECIFICATIONS  at end of article.
  2. To complete installation, reverse removal procedure. DO NOT tighten ball joint stud nuts more than an additional 1/6 turn to align cotter pin hole.
  3. Lubricate ball joints and tie rods with grease. Check and adjust ride height. See Figure and Figure . Check front end alignment as necessary. See WHEEL ALIGNMENT article.
